Gobena, Jepchirchir power to Sydney Marathon victories

Ethiopia’s Addisu Gobena and Kenyan world champion, Peres, surged to commanding wins Sunday in the men’s and women’s races respectively at the Sydney Marathon.
Victory was the first in a World Marathon Major for 21-year-old Gobena, who came second last year, while Jepchirchir added to her previous triumphs in Boston, New York and London.
Gobena made his move in the last kilometre to power home four seconds clear of compatriot Chimdessa Debele Gudeta in 2hrs 04min 42sec. Lesotho’s Tebello Ramakongoana came third.
The dominant run shattered the course record by almost one-and-half minutes, with last year’s winner Hailemaryam Kiros dropping from the pace in the dying stages.

The unstoppable Jepchirchir was in a league of her own, crossing the finish line in front of the Sydney Opera House in 2:18:31, nearly four minutes ahead of fellow Kenyan Irine Cheptai and Ethiopia’s Shure Demise Ware.
In the men’s race, the leading pack had thinned to 15 by the halfway mark, with Gobena, world champion Alphonce Simbu and Kiros among them.
Jepchirchir and Cheptai eased clear and the relentless world champion then put her foot to the floor, finishing nine seconds off the course record set by Olympic champion Sifan Hassan in 2025.
American Daniel Romanchuk won the men’s wheelchair race, while Switzerland’s Manuela Schar, a three-time Paralympic gold medal winner, took out the women’s.
Around 40 000 runners, a record, competed over the picturesque 42.19 kilometres course through the city from North Sydney, over the Harbour Bridge to the finish line on the forecourt of the Opera House.
The race was elevated last year to the seventh World Marathon Major, putting it on a par with London, Tokyo, Boston, Berlin, Chicago and New York in the elite global series.-AFP
